We moved over at the end of August this year. Believe me when I say we felt *exactly* like you do right now.

We found the last week in the UK really stressful - especially as I still had work engagements, we were selling our cars, saying goodbye to friends and family (most of whom were crying at this point), having to juggle hire cars, sort out the van (we moved ourselves), sort out the animals, etc, etc. A real emotional roller coaster. There were lots of loose ends to tie up - our house in the UK to clean, addresses to change, etc, etc, etc, etc, etc. We made lists, and in the end we had lists of lists of lists!

The actual move itself was hard work (mainly because I did it all myself) but extremely rewarding. Our (then) five year old daughter and Jack Russell terrier pup came along in the van and a great time was had by all. I sent regular photos by MMS back to Mrs Twyntub who was flying with our two year old and the cat as we drove across Spain from Santander. Despite 'cutting down' - I gave up numbering the boxes going into the van at 146...

Within a week of moving here, the house was straight, the boxes had gone away, and we had started to get into a routine with normal life things (shopping, children, animals, etc). Then the kids started at school.

All in all, we've been too busy to be worried about what we left behind, and in being busy we've also met a whole new set of wonderful friends - not just Brits but Spaniards, Dutch, Belgians, Norwegians, etc very very quickly.

At no point do we look back and wonder why we did it, only how! And whilst some friends are really surprised that we're not coming 'back home' for Christmas, it's because we're already home here in Spain.
